The Land

The 36.96 Acres (14.96 Hectares) of Land is classified Grade III according to the Agricultural Land Classification Plans of England and Wales. The soil type is of the Whimple 3 Soil Association with fine loamy/silty over clayey soils. The productive Land has been previously been used for Arable Cropping, Agricultural Grazing and Mowing. Available as a whole of in three lots the Land lends itself to a range of agricultural and non-agricultural amenity uses, subject to the relevant permissions. Lot One (outlined blue on the enclosed plan) A versatile parcel of approximately 3.15 acres (1.27 hectares) with direct access from Trent Lane. Well suited to equestrian or general amenity use, the land is crossed by a public footpath and overhead wayleave. Lot Two (outlined red on the enclosed plan) 28.24 acres (11.43 hectares) of historic land, home to The East Bridgford Motte and Bailey Castle, believed to date from the 11th or 12th century and designated as a Scheduled Monument (truncated)

De-Linked Payments & Environmental Stewardship

No De-linked payments will be made available to a successful Purchaser. The Land is not entered into any Agri-Environmental Stewardship Schemes.

Overage Clause

The Land is subject to an existing Overage Clause, from a previous Sale. Where a 25% uplift payment will be made should the Land be used for any other use than Farmland and Ancillary Landscaping and Infrastructure for a period expiring on the 9th of December 2037. Further details are available from the Vendors.

Wayleaves, Easements & Rights of Way

The Land is sold subject to and with the benefit of all rights, including rights of way whether public or private and all Easements and Wayleaves whether specifically mentioned or not. Lot One is crossed by an overhead electricity wayleave, while Lot Two is crossed by a sewage pipeline easement. A public bridlepath crosses Lot Three, with public footpaths running through Lots One and Two.

Tenure & Possession

The Land is sold Freehold, and Vacant Possession will be given on Completion.

Sporting, Timber & Mineral Rights

All Sporting and Timber, Mines and Mineral rights are included in the Freehold sale so far as they are owned. The Mines and Mineral Rights are excluded from Lot Three.

Holdover

The Vendor reserves the right of holdover for the purposes of harvesting the current Winter Wheat crop.

Location

The land is on the outskirts of East Bridgford. East Bridgford is one of South Nottinghamshire's most desirable villages situated on the edge of the Trent Valley. The Village offers a village hall, tennis club and public house where further amenities are available at nearby Radcliffe on Trent and Bingham. The Village is ideally placed for fast access to Nottingham, Newark and Southwell along with both the wider North and South via the nearby A46.
